Poly(Amide-Imide)S Based on Amino end Capped Oligoimides

ABSTRACT:

An amino end capped oligoimide was prepared by the Michael addition reaction of hexamethylene bismaleimide (HBM) and 4,4'-diamino diphenyl-sulphone (DDS) at an HBM:DDS molar ratio of 1:2. The poly (amide-imide)s (PAI)s were prepared by condensation of this HBMDDS oligoimide with various aliphatic bisesters. The resultant PAIs were characterized by elemental analysis and the average molecular weight estimated by non-aqueous conductometric titration and thermogravimetry. The curing reaction of an expoxy resin [a diglycidyl ether of bisphenol-A (DGEBA)] with PAIs was monitored by differential scanning calorimetry (DSC). Glass and carbon reinforced laminates of PAI-epoxy resin were also prepared and characterized.
